Установить сервер на Linux не просто легко, а очень легко. Но в репозиториях всегда устаревшие версии программ. Например, PHP там ветки 5.5.
Ubuntu (и, естественно, Linux Mint) по умолчанию поставляются с PHP 5.5, но если вы хотите использовать PHP 5.6, то вас от этого отделяют всего три строки в командной строке. Говорят, что нижеследующая инструкция для «чистой установки». Т.е. для тех, кто ещё не успел поставить PHP, и что она не для обновления уже установленного PHP. Я не знаю, но у меня всё сработало прекрасно, хотя PHP я установил вместе с свервером в той инструкции, на которую выше дал ссылку. При установке на «чистую» систему, всё должно пройти идеально — проверено на многих машинах. При обновлении существующего PHP появятся дополнительные вопросы о конфигурационном файле (я поменял на новый из пакета, но вы можете поступить по своему желанию — синтаксис файла настройки одинаков для PHP 5.5 и для PHP 5.6.
Апач также работает, я проверил.
1. Добавляем источник пакета PHP 5.6 на вашу систему:
sudo add-apt-repository ppa:ondrej/php5-5.6
и подтверждаем с ENTER. Если вы видите здесь ошибку, вам нужно установить в первую очередь python-software-properties (а затем вернуться опять к предыдущему шагу):
sudo apt-get update sudo apt-get install python-software-properties
2. Обновление
sudo apt-get update
3. Установка PHP
sudo apt-get install php5
для проверки версии делаем:
php5 -v
Ура! Между прочим, этот предельно-простой-для-установки пакет PHP 5.6 был создан Ondřej Surý, следовательно, можете подумать о стимулировании этого человека, подкинув ему деньжат на пиво или на кофе на его странице помощи.
Как его запустить? Не работает у меня локальный сервер. В смысле не исполняются сценарии php